Understanding Custom Window Installations
Custom window setups include the manufacture and fitting of windows developed and constructed to meet particular measurements and stylistic preferences of a property owner. Unlike standard window installations, which are mass-produced in fixed sizes, custom windows use unlimited possibilities for looks and efficiency.

The Custom Window Installation Process
Setting up custom windows is a comprehensive process that requires mindful planning and execution. Below are the primary steps included:
| Step | Description |
|---|---|
| 1. Consultation | Property owners meet with custom window installers to talk about needs, choices, and budget plan. |
| 2. Measurement | Specific measurements of the window openings are taken to make sure an ideal fit. |
| 3. Design Selection | House owners choose products, designs, colors, and any other style components for their custom windows. |
| 4. Production | Windows are produced based on the agreed-upon specifications. |
| 5. Installation | Professional installers thoroughly remove old windows (if suitable) and fit the new custom windows. |
| 6. Last Inspection | The installation is examined for quality and performance, ensuring whatever meets the needed standards. |

Factors to Consider When Choosing Custom Window Installers
When selecting a custom window installer, several aspects must be taken into consideration to make sure an acceptable experience:
- Reputation: Research the installer's track record through evaluations, testimonials, and referrals.
- Experience: Look for installers with substantial experience in custom window installations, as they are likely to be more knowledgeable.
- Licensing and Insurance: Verify that the installer is licensed and guaranteed to secure against potential damages or accidents.
- Portfolio: Review the installer's portfolio of previous projects to guarantee their design visual aligns with your vision.
- Quotes and Pricing: Obtain numerous quotes to compare pricing, but likewise consider the quality of materials and craftsmanship offered.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How much do custom windows cost?
Custom window rates can differ considerably based on materials, style, size, and installation requirements. It's encouraged to obtain numerous price quotes to get a much better idea of the rates.
2. What see page are utilized for custom windows?
Common materials for custom windows consist of vinyl, wood, fiberglass, and aluminum. Each material has its benefits and disadvantages, depending on the particular needs of the house owner.
3. How long does the installation process take?
The installation time can vary based upon elements such as the variety of windows being installed and the complexity of the style. Usually, an uncomplicated installation can take one to three days.
4. Will I need to get licenses for custom window installation?
Local building codes differ, but many municipalities require permits for window replacements or installations. Custom window installers generally assist with this procedure.
